Why You Should Never Use the Quick Wash Cycle – The Truth About Your Laundry!
Many people rely on the quick wash cycle when they’re in a hurry, thinking it saves time, water, and energy. But is it really the best option for your clothes and washing machine? The answer might surprise you!
Here’s why you should think twice before using quick wash and when it’s actually okay to use it.
🚨 The Downsides of the Quick Wash Cycle
1️⃣ Clothes Don’t Get Fully Clean
Quick wash cycles don’t give detergent enough time to break down dirt, sweat, and bacteria.
✔ They work best for lightly soiled clothes, but not for deep cleaning.
✔ Solution: Use a regular or deep-clean cycle for anything heavily worn.
2️⃣ Bacteria & Germs Aren’t Properly Killed
✔ Quick washes use lower temperatures (often 30-40°C / 86-104°F), which are too low to kill bacteria and mold.
✔ This is especially bad for underwear, gym clothes, towels, and baby clothes.
✔ Solution: Wash germ-prone items at 60°C (140°F) or higher for proper disinfection.
